Mercurial > hg > xemacs-beta
comparison lisp/code-process.el @ 371:cc15677e0335 r21-2b1
Import from CVS: tag r21-2b1
author | cvs |
---|---|
date | Mon, 13 Aug 2007 11:03:08 +0200 |
parents | 972bbb6d6ca2 |
children | 8626e4521993 |
comparison
equal
deleted
inserted
replaced
370:bd866891f083 | 371:cc15677e0335 |
---|---|
133 (if (functionp ret) | 133 (if (functionp ret) |
134 (setq ret (funcall ret 'call-process-region program))) | 134 (setq ret (funcall ret 'call-process-region program))) |
135 (cond ((consp ret) | 135 (cond ((consp ret) |
136 (setq cs-r (car ret) | 136 (setq cs-r (car ret) |
137 cs-w (cdr ret))) | 137 cs-w (cdr ret))) |
138 ((null ret) | |
139 (setq cs-r buffer-file-coding-system | |
140 cs-w buffer-file-coding-system)) | |
141 ((find-coding-system ret) | 138 ((find-coding-system ret) |
142 (setq cs-r ret | 139 (setq cs-r ret |
143 cs-w ret)))) | 140 cs-w ret)))) |
144 (let ((coding-system-for-read | 141 (let ((coding-system-for-read |
145 (or coding-system-for-read cs-r)) | 142 (or coding-system-for-read cs-r)) |